Wanted: New Leaders For South Dakota

A new group is forming to help train the next generation of leaders in South Dakota.

Former state education secretary Rick Melmer says “Leadership South Dakota” would look for a small class of individuals each year…

 

Melmer says they have a certain focus in mind…

 

The group would meet once a month, in seven towns across the state on a variety of topics and state issues.

 

Melmer says they would like to find a diverse group…

 

Melmer says the cost would be three thousand dollars per participant. He says some of that cost could be covered by a person’s employer along with some grant money.

The program is sponsored by the South Dakota Community Foundation, the Bush Foundation, and corporate partners. Deadline to apply is May 30th.
